知识问答
您的DnD服务器为何无响应?
在网络世界中,DNS服务器扮演着至关重要的角色,它负责将我们输入的域名转换为对应的IP地址,使得数据能够在网络上正确传输,当遇到“DNS服务器无响应”的问题时,不仅影响了上网体验,还可能阻碍了重要的工作和通信,以下是对这一问题的深入分析:
DNS服务器无响应的原因
1、网络设置问题:
错误的DNS服务器地址配置是常见的原因之一,用户可能手动设置了错误的DNS服务器地址,或者自动获取的DNS服务器地址有误,导致无***常解析域名。
网络连接不稳定或断开也会导致DNS服务器无响应,这可能是由于网络供应商的问题,或者是用户自己的网络设备故障。
2、DNS服务器故障:
DNS服务器本身可能出现故障,如服务器宕机、过载或配置错误,这些都会导致无法响应客户端的请求。
DNS缓存问题也可能导致无响应,当DNS服务器的缓存中存在错误的记录时,可能会导致解析失败。
3、防火墙和安全软件设置:
过于严格的防火墙规则可能会阻止DNS请求的通过,用户需要检查防火墙设置,确保允许DNS流量的通过。
安全软件可能会错误地将DNS请求识别为威胁并拦截,需要调整安全软件的设置以允许DNS通信。
4、系统和软件问题:
操作系统的网络组件损坏或配置不当可能导致DNS请求无法发送或接收,在这种情况下,可能需要重置网络设置或重新安装相关组件。
过时或不兼容的网络驱动程序也可能导致DNS服务器无响应,更新或更换驱动程序可能解决问题。
5、硬件故障:
网卡或其他网络硬件的故障可能导致无法与DNS服务器通信,检查硬件状态并进行必要的更换或维修是解决此类问题的关键。
解决DNS服务器无响应的方法
1、检查网络连接:
确保网络连接稳定,可以尝试重启路由器和调制解调器,检查网络线缆是否连接良好,无线信号是否稳定。
2、更改DNS服务器地址:
如果怀疑是DNS服务器地址配置错误,可以尝试更改为公共DNS服务器地址,如Google的8.8.8.8或Cloudflare的1.1.1.1。
3、清除DNS缓存:
在Windows系统中,可以通过命令提示符使用ipconfig /flushdns
命令来清除DNS缓存。
4、检查防火墙和安全软件设置:
确保防火墙和安全软件不会阻止DNS请求,可以临时禁用这些软件来测试是否是它们导致的问题。
5、重置网络设置:
在Windows系统中,可以通过netsh winsock reset
命令来重置网络堆栈,这通常可以解决由网络配置引起的问题。
6、更新或重新安装网络驱动程序:
确保网络适配器的驱动程序是最新的,如果问题依旧,尝试卸载并重新安装驱动程序。
7、联系网络服务提供商:
如果以上方法都无法解决问题,可能是网络服务提供商(ISP)的DNS服务器出现问题,需要联系他们进行排查。
FAQs
1、为什么更改DNS服务器地址可以解决DNS服务器无响应的问题?
更改DNS服务器地址可以避免使用可能存在问题的默认DNS服务器,转而使用更可靠或速度更快的公共DNS服务器,从而提高解析成功率。
2、如何判断DNS服务器无响应是由硬件故障引起的?
可以通过排除法来判断,首先检查软件配置和网络设置,如果问题依旧,再考虑可能是硬件故障,可以使用其他设备测试相同的网络连接,如果其他设备正常,那么原设备的网卡或相关硬件可能存在问题。
DNS服务器无响应是一个多因素导致的问题,需要从多个角度进行排查和解决,通过上述分析和建议,用户可以更好地理解和处理这一问题,恢复网络连接的稳定性。